#3d5139 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3d5139 is composed of 23.9% red, 31.8% green and 22.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 29.6% yellow and 68.2% black. It has a hue angle of 110 degrees, a saturation of 17.4% and a lightness of 27.1%. #3d5139 color hex could be obtained by blending #7aa272 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#3d5139 color description : Very dark grayish lime green.
#3d5139 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3d5139 has RGB values of R:61, G:81, B:57 and CMYK values of C:0.25, M:0, Y:0.3, K:0.68. Its decimal value is 4018489.
